Description: A vulnerability has been reported in Siemens C450IP / C475IP, which can be exploited by malicious people to cause a DoS (Denial of Service).
The vulnerability is caused due to an error in the processing of SIP messages. This can be exploited to disconnect all active calls and reboot the device via a specially crafted UDP packet sent to port 5060.
